Mauritian rum is crafted using both molasses and fresh sugarcane juice, resulting in a variety of styles and flavours. The island’s distilleries skillfully harness the natural sweetness of the sugarcane, creating rums that are rich, flavourful, and distinctly Mauritian. Fresh sugarcane juice rums, also known as “rhum agricole,” are a point of pride for Mauritius. These rums are made directly from freshly pressed sugarcane juice, capturing the essence of the sugarcane in its purest form. Rhum agricole from Mauritius is celebrated for its bright, grassy notes and vibrant, fruity character.
